Product Description:
Sodium 1-butanesulfonate is widely used as a surfactant in various industrial and household cleaning products. Its ability to reduce surface tension makes it effective in detergents, helping to remove dirt and grease from surfaces. In the textile industry, it is utilized as a wetting agent to improve the penetration of dyes and other chemicals into fabrics. Additionally, it serves as a stabilizer in polymerization processes, ensuring consistent quality in the production of plastics and resins. In analytical chemistry, it is employed as a mobile phase additive in high-performance liquid chromatography (HPLC) to enhance the separation of compounds. Its versatility and effectiveness in these applications make it a valuable chemical in multiple fields.
